Transaction 838500e436e1571494c0ce590a33e7a2008e62c397221e9dd0b88b062d06f6e9
1 Input
1 Output
-
838500e436e1571494c0ce590a33e7a2008e62c397221e9dd0b88b062d06f6e9:0
- value
- 529923
- script pubkey
- OP_0 OP_PUSHBYTES_20 e073983fa5821ac071312e595fab9d76171ce429
- address
- bc1qupees0a9sgdvquf39ev4l2uawct3eepfcswj45